Transaction 93242a3fabfa512f2da80fd41e26e28ad3af8cb8872b3073097a0d0dff80e4a6
2 Input
2 Outputs
- 93242a3fabfa512f2da80fd41e26e28ad3af8cb8872b3073097a0d0dff80e4a6:0
- 93242a3fabfa512f2da80fd41e26e28ad3af8cb8872b3073097a0d0dff80e4a6:1
value 900030
address 15urTDrEzBqL6Y7Kmmd2YBVKyd8WApbBq8
value 48950317
address 3PpaKwVVGyw97addoZGvgCthR3DSdju3oE